Output 50dfaa68e5f9480f8000592de93ea1f2c94dcc9ea57bde06747a89980d969fe9:41

value
72683268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b60fbacc2d4efd4ca27ed1556e5e610909263a OP_EQUAL
address
MFSVk1bsRZGeCYK2jdzmCrJhFsg77MLHVa
transaction
50dfaa68e5f9480f8000592de93ea1f2c94dcc9ea57bde06747a89980d969fe9
spent
true